#4c2911 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c2911 is composed of 29.8% red, 16.1%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 24.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 18.2%. #4c2911 color hex could be obtained by blending #985222 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#4c2911 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#4c2911 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c2911 has RGB values of R:76, G:41,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.78,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4991249.

Shades and Tints of #4c2911
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0603 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c2911
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2e2e is the less saturated color, while #5a2603 is the most saturated one.
